This print from the Liszt Collection showcases a collection of stunning drawings titled "Studies Ships Boats mid-17th-early 18th century" by Willem van de Velde II, a renowned Dutch artist. The artwork is rendered in exquisite detail using pen and black ink on a sheet measuring 11 1/4 x 6 15/16 inches (285 x 176 cm). Van de Velde's mastery shines through as he captures the essence of ships and boats during this period with remarkable precision. Each stroke of his pen brings to life the intricate rigging, towering masts, and graceful hulls that defined maritime vessels during the mid-17th to early 18th century. The artist's deep understanding of naval architecture is evident in these drawings, showcasing an array of ship types that were prevalent during this era. From majestic warships brimming with cannons to nimble fishing boats navigating treacherous waters, Van de Velde's attention to detail transports us back in time. As we gaze upon this Artokoloro print, we are transported into a world where sailors embarked on daring voyages across vast oceans. The skillful use of black ink creates a sense of drama and depth within each drawing, further enhancing our connection to these historical vessels. Willem van de Velde II's legacy as one of the greatest marine painters is beautifully preserved in this exceptional collection.
